Subtract 21/70 from 14/36
14/36 - 21/70 is 4/45.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 36 and 70 is 1260
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 1260 - For the 1st fraction, since 36 × 35 = 1260,
14/36 = 14 × 35/36 × 35 = 490/1260 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 70 × 18 = 1260,
21/70 = 21 × 18/70 × 18 = 378/1260 - Subtract the two like fractions:
490/1260 - 378/1260 = 490 - 378/1260 = 112/1260 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 4/45
